SQL表格
2016-05-23 20:50
253 查看
LAMP - Linux Apache MySQL PHP
MySQL - 三个层次:文件层次,服务层次,界面
常用的数据类型:
int 整数
float double decimal 小数
varchar char 字符串
bit bool型
datetime 日期时间
建表的一般经验:分类、分层、分步
1.分类:
2.mn关系:1对1,1对多,多对多?
一、实体完整性:
主键:唯一,必填;排序;每个表只能有一个主键。单列,组合列。
自增长:必须是数字,系统自动增加的。
默认值:如果不填就用默认值填充,如果填了就用填 写的值保存。
非空约束:
二、引用完整
外键:两个表(主表,从表),建在从表上。
主表:用来约束别人的表
从表:受约束的表。
主从表只对指定的两个表有意义
MySQL - 三个层次:文件层次,服务层次,界面
常用的数据类型:
int 整数
float double decimal 小数
varchar char 字符串
bit bool型
datetime 日期时间
建表的一般经验:分类、分层、分步
1.分类:
2.mn关系:1对1,1对多,多对多?
一、实体完整性:
主键:唯一,必填;排序;每个表只能有一个主键。单列,组合列。
自增长:必须是数字,系统自动增加的。
默认值:如果不填就用默认值填充,如果填了就用填 写的值保存。
非空约束:
二、引用完整
外键:两个表(主表,从表),建在从表上。
主表:用来约束别人的表
从表:受约束的表。
主从表只对指定的两个表有意义
相关文章推荐
- oracle导入csv文本文件到vertica
- 允许ubuntu下mysql远程连接
- oracle 高级分组
- Oracle 存储过程中的循环语句写法
- Oracle 游标 与 存储过程
- Oracle存储过程中游标For循环使用
- PL/SQL如何调试Oracle存储过程
- MySql的Date函数
- Redis源码分析(一):aeMain()函数概述
- 安装 sql server 2008 过程中遇到的问题及解决措施
- 数据库的操作
- 如何面对ubuntu mysql ----->>> Access denied for user 'root'@'localhost'
- SQL SERVER 建表table之前,检查是否有同名的表存在
- 关于mybatis用mysql时,插入返回自增主键的问题
- 最万能的解决mysql数据库的各种问题的办法
- 【SHELL】监控Nginx运行,Mysql主从运行,主从复制延迟
- 第10章 C# 数据库编程技术
- MySql Unknown column 的解决方案
- mysql设置密码
- mysql基本操作,创建、删除用户并授权给数据库,创建、删除、查看数据库和表